About University Science Fairs
University science fairs are organized events where students present their research projects to faculty, peers, and industry professionals. These fairs can cover various disciplines, including biology, chemistry, physics, engineering, and environmental science. The format usually includes poster presentations, oral presentations, and sometimes interactive demonstrations.

Preparing for a Science Fair
Choosing a Research Topic
Selecting an engaging and relevant research topic is crucial. Here are some tips:
- Interest and Passion: Choose a subject you are passionate about; your enthusiasm will be evident in your presentation.
- Feasibility: Ensure the topic is feasible within the available time and resources.
- Relevance: Consider current issues in society, such as climate change, health, or technology.
Conducting Research
Once a topic is chosen, thorough research is essential. Follow these steps:
- Literature Review: Study existing research to understand the background and context of your topic.
- Methodology: Develop a clear methodology for conducting experiments or collecting data.
- Data Analysis: Analyze your findings using appropriate statistical methods.
Creating the Presentation
A well-organized presentation is key to effectively communicating your research. Consider the following elements:
- Poster Design: Use clear headings, visuals, and bullet points to make information easy to digest.
- Practice: Rehearse your presentation multiple times to gain confidence and ensure clarity.
- Engagement: Prepare to engage with your audience through Q&A sessions or discussions.

Judging Criteria
Understanding the judging criteria can help you focus your efforts. Common criteria include:
- Research Quality: The depth and rigor of the research conducted.
- Presentation: Clarity, organization, and creativity in the presentation.
- Engagement: The ability to engage the audience and answer questions effectively.
